Costume variant No. 1

Perhaps the easiest way to make an alien costume at home. Before starting work, you need to prepare:

    Work uniform of the builder (it can be purchased at any special store);

    mosquito net;

    small springs;

  • plastic balls.

    If the building form is larger than you need, cut off the legs, sleeves, slightly sew in the elastic in the waistband.

    Let's start with the alien hat. You need to make two eyes and sew to the jumpsuit. For their manufacture, foam rubber is needed. Cut out a circle about 25 cm in size, pull it together with a thread so that you get a ball, and cover it with a mosquito net. Place the edge of the mesh in the middle, sew a plastic ball on top.

    Similarly, make another one and sew the eyes to the hood on opposite sides. The front of the hood, where the child's face will be, must also be sheathed with a mosquito net.

    Cut out two oval mesh pieces. Cut the back of the overalls from top to bottom so that the cuts are smaller than the cut out oval pieces. Sew the details into the cuts - these are the alien's wings.

    You can also sew a mesh fabric along the inside seam of the panties. So the child will be more comfortable if the holiday takes place in the warm season.

    To make the DIY alien costume even more effective, make two more foam rubber arms and cover them with mosquito net and material left over from the overalls. When the arms are ready, sew them on at the level of the side seams.

To sew a festive costume you will need:

  • cotton-based lacquer fabric or any other shiny fabric: dark gray - 200x130 cm, light gray - 65x110 cm;
  • shiny braid - 200x2 cm;
  • lightning - 15 cm;
  • synthetic winterizer - 55x50 cm;
  • elastic band - 20 cm.
  • The pattern with patterns is given at the bottom of the article.

How to make a children's holiday costume

Suit jacket

1. Cut out details from dark gray fabric according to schemes 1, 2 and 6, and from light gray fabric - details according to schemes 3, 7 and 8.

2. Fold the dark gray front piece with the light gray front piece and sew (sewing sides in diagrams 2 and 3 are marked in blue). Similarly, sew the second dark gray piece on the opposite side of the light gray piece. Sew on blue ribbons (see photo).

3. Sew the front and back of the sweater along the side seams. Sew in the zipper (see Diagram 1).

4. Focusing on diagram 6, sew blue ribbons on the sleeves. Sew the seams of the sleeves. Sew along the edge of each cuff with a dark gray fabric and sew onto the sleeves. Sew on the sleeves.

5 Sew blue ribbons onto the collar (see photo and diagram 7) and sew around the edge with a dark gray fabric. Sew the collar to the neck of the sweater.

Pants for a suit

1. Cut out the details from the dark gray fabric according to schemes 4 and 5. Fold the parts in pairs and sew the side seams (the stitching points are marked in red in the diagram).

2. Now complete the crotch (inside) and center seams on the front and back of the pants. Hem the bottom of each leg and the waistband of the trousers by 1 cm, leaving 2 cm open. Insert the elastic into the resulting drawstrings.

suit helmet

1. Cut out the details according to scheme 10: two for each part - from a dark gray fabric and two - from a padding polyester. And according to scheme 9: four parts from light gray fabric and two from sintepon.

2. Fold the details of the helmet from the fabric in pairs together with the wrong side inward, laying the details from the padding polyester between them. Sew along the edge and then sew the side seams.

3. Fold the details of the ears from the fabric in pairs with the wrong side inward, laying the details from the padding polyester between them. Run around the circumference of each resulting part 9 lines at a distance of 1 cm from one another.

4. Sew along the edge of each ear with a dark gray fabric, and sew a blue ribbon around the edge on the inside. Sew the ears to the helmet. From the remnants of the fabric, sew the eyes and sew on the helmet.

To make this magnificent space helmet, we inflate a large round balloon to the required volume. Then we put wet paper towels on its surface. The next few layers are small pieces of paper smeared with PVA glue. We are waiting for the glue to dry. We pierce the balloon and take it out through the resulting small holes. We make an oval slot in the helmet.

We glue the blank of the helmet with foil.

To make a visor, you need a transparent thin plastic. This happens on the packaging of children's toys. We cut out an elliptical visor from it. We pierce along two edges and fasten with cheap children's earrings.

To get the most real oxygen cylinders, you need to wrap them in foil. They can be attached to the belt or to the suit itself with double-sided tape.

To make a dashboard on an astronaut suit, we use cardboard, holographic paper, and old CDs. If you are good with electrical devices, you can attach a small garland with a battery to the structure. See how the front panel on the suit glows in the dark.

We make real space shoes as follows: we wrap rubber boots with foil and lightly attach it on top with tape. Our astronaut is ready. Now we only need a space rocket!

Boy's hedgehog costume

Variant of a small hedgehog for a masquerade:

Simplified version:

  • cape with a hood and sewn needles;
  • jumpsuit or shirt with trousers;
  • mushrooms, leaves, fruits, tinsel-rain in the form of decor;
  • shoes.

In both options, you make needles to the hedgehog with your own hands. Cut out many circles from the fabric of the desired color. The radius of the circle will be equal to the length of the hedgehog's needle. In each circle, one quarter (wedge) is removed and a cone is sewn. When there is a sufficient number of cones, you can sew them to the vest, hat, cape and hood. If you replace the trousers with a skirt, then you will have a charming hedgehog girl. Add makeup to the baby's face - and your hedgehog is ready. By the way, the dinosaur costume is also made, only the cones should be larger.

Little astronaut

The basis of clothing can be a red jumpsuit or a suit of silver brocade - these are the two main colors for such a suit. Once you've decided on your astronaut's attire, you can start creating the specific suit accessories: helmet and balloons. And also trim children's boots so that they look like astronauts' shoes.

Let's start building a helmet. We will make it using the papier-mâché technique. We will need:

  • a large round balloon;
  • a lot of old newspapers, sheets of thin paper;
  • 1 st. flour;
  • water and white latex paint.

A future astronaut will help you tear the paper into small strips and pieces. Thoroughly mix flour and water in a cup until a creamy mass is obtained.

We inflate a balloon larger than the child's head and put strips of paper soaked in dough on it in even layers. The bottom of the ball remains unglued. This left a hole for the head and neck, it should be larger in diameter than the head of a baby astronaut.

Carefully burst the ball after the structure has completely dried, remove the rubber residue from the inside. We cover the top of the helmet with white paint. Mark with a pencil and carefully cut out a window for the face. The resulting uneven edges should be sealed with a white adhesive plaster.

You can make fuel cylinders from two 1.5-liter bottles wrapped in silver foil and fastened with tape. We attach “tongues of fire” made of red fabric, napkins or corrugated paper to the nozzles of the cylinders.

Fallen leaf dress

The basis is an old T-shirt or T-shirt. The main material is whole dry leaves. The leaves are attached to the bodice of the dress with a needle and thread. The straps are decorated with wreaths of leaves. The same wreath can be put on the hem of a skirt or on a belt. The one-piece skirt of a stylish suit is assembled from leaves from the bottom row up, overlapping. An unpleasant feature of such a product is that the leaves wither very quickly and become brittle, therefore such an outfit must be prepared on the eve of the show. A dark, damp and cool room is suitable for storing such a dress.

Laserdisc Outfit

An old T-shirt or dress and a bunch of damaged laser discs can easily be turned into a super-suit for a dance floor star. Necessary tools: shoe awl, scissors, needle and thread.

We heat the awl and make a hole in each disc. Choose a T-shirt that reaches mid-thigh. From the bottom, move in a circle and rise, gradually decorating the entire space. On the shoulders, sew discs with two holes on both sides.
